This applet shows a ray diagram demonstrating Snell's Law and Total Internal Reflection. A point source is in a medium with an unknown index of refraction and rays from the source enter a second medium with a smaller index of refraction (air).  The user can adjust the position of the source and the angle of the rays, and the applet shows the bending of the rays as they enter the air.  Positions and angles can be measured on the applet. The challenge for this applet is to determine the index of refraction of the first medium.

This is part of a large collection of Physlet-based (Physics Java Applet) illustrations and tutorials covering introductory physics.
